Chaplaincy Program

The Albuquerque International Sunport provides pastoral care for people on the move through its inter-religious chaplaincy program.  Sunport chaplains reach out to people at the Sunport who sometimes find themselves caught up in the frantic pace of today’s global environment.  The hustle and bustle of air transportation with its focus on schedules, connections and security can be stressful for passengers, their families, and airport employees.  When someone at the Sunport finds themselves in need of a compassionate ear or someone to turn to for advice, Sunport chaplains are available either on the premises or through a 24/7 pager (YOU-CHAP/968-2427). Any of the chaplains at the Albuquerque International Sunport stand ready to help people with any of their spiritual needs, including contacting local spiritual leaders of major religions or joining them in silent prayer in the Meditation Room.The Sunport chaplaincy program is administered by the Sunport Chaplaincy Authority, a non-profit, 501(c)(3) corporation.  The SCA does not charge for its service and donations are always welcome.  (Please call 505-610-3353)

Airport Chaplains

Sunport chaplains are volunteers who serve in a completely inter-religious spiritual capacity.  Although the spiritual strength of each chaplain is rooted within his/her particular religion, the Albuquerque Sunport does not intend for their service to represent the presence of any particular belief group or system.  Rather, the chaplains minister to all Sunport employees, travelers, and guests without regard to the person’s religious creed.

Meditation Room

Guests, travelers and employees at the Sunport who wish to spend some quiet time away from the hustle and bustle are welcome to use the new Meditation Room located on the First Level across from Baggage Claim Area 8.
